var cd = new ActiveXObject("ChartDirector.API");

// The x and y coordinates of the grid
var dataX = [0, 0.1, 0.2, 0.3, 0.4, 0.5, 0.6, 0.7, 0.8, 0.9, 1.0];
var dataY = [0, 0.1, 0.2, 0.3, 0.4, 0.5, 0.6, 0.7, 0.8, 0.9, 1.0];

// The values at the grid points. In this example, we will compute the values using
// the formula z = sin((x - 0.5) * 2 * pi) * sin((y - 0.5) * 2 * pi)
var dataZ = new Array((dataX.length) * (dataY.length));
for (var yIndex = 0; yIndex < dataY.length; ++yIndex) {
    var y = (dataY[yIndex] - 0.5) * 2 * 3.1416;
    for (var xIndex = 0; xIndex < dataX.length; ++xIndex) {
        var x = (dataX[xIndex] - 0.5) * 2 * 3.1416;
        dataZ[yIndex * (dataX.length) + xIndex] = Math.sin(x) * Math.sin(y);
    }
}

// Create a SurfaceChart object of size 720 x 540 pixels
var c = cd.SurfaceChart(720, 540);

// Add a title to the chart using 20 points Times New Roman Italic font
c.addTitle("Quantum Wave Function", "timesi.ttf", 20);

// Set the center of the plot region at (360, 245), and set width x depth x height to
// 360 x 360 x 270 pixels
c.setPlotRegion(360, 245, 360, 360, 270);

// Set the elevation and rotation angles to 20 and 30 degrees
c.setViewAngle(20, 30);

// Set the data to use to plot the chart
c.setData(dataX, dataY, dataZ);

// Spline interpolate data to a 80 x 80 grid for a smooth surface
c.setInterpolation(80, 80);

// Set surface grid lines to semi-transparent black (dd000000)
c.setSurfaceAxisGrid(0xdd000000);

// Set contour lines to semi-transparent white (80ffffff)
c.setContourColor(0x80ffffff);

// Add a color axis (the legend) in which the left center is anchored at (645, 270).
// Set the length to 200 pixels and the labels on the right side. Use smooth gradient
// coloring.
c.setColorAxis(645, 270, cd.Left, 200, cd.Right).setColorGradient();

// Set the x, y and z axis titles using 10 points Arial Bold font
c.xAxis().setTitle("x/L(x)", "arialbd.ttf", 10);
c.yAxis().setTitle("y/L(y)", "arialbd.ttf", 10);
c.zAxis().setTitle("Wave Function Amplitude", "arialbd.ttf", 10);

// Output the chart
c.makeChart(WScript.ScriptFullName + "/../surface2.jpg");
